Semester 1 exam includes six pages of 46 multiple choice questions and two graphing questions.
Students will be assessed on linear equations (intercepts, slope, transformations, graphing, solving), exponential functions, proportions, order of operations, properties of exponents, functions, translating verbal expressions, literal equations, domain and range, arithmetic and geometric functions, systems of equations and inequalities, and evaluating expressions.
